Billboard of gun-toting Santa draws controversy in Chico

CHICO (AP) — A billboard showing Santa Claus carrying an automatic rifle is drawing controversy in a Northern California town.

The billboard put up on the outskirts of Chico comes with the slogan “We build AR’s for Santa,” and advertises for a gun range that assembles such weapons for sale.

The gun range owners told Action News Now they didn’t intend to make the ad offensive. They said some people give guns as Christmas presents, and they put the ad up along a highway on the outskirts of town to draw attention to their fledgling business.

One resident said juxtaposing a symbol of joy and giving with a weapon is “just so contradictory.” Another woman said she wouldn’t want her son to see Santa holding a gun.
